    ISO 9362 is an international standard for Business Identifier Codes (BIC), a unique identifier for business institutions, [1] approved by the International Organization for Standardization (ISO). [2] BIC is also known as SWIFT-BIC , SWIFT ID , or SWIFT code , after the Society for Worldwide Interbank Financial Telecommunication (SWIFT), which ...
